What are your thoughts on value based pricing?
@RossWelch
@RossWelch 2 жыл бұрын
Hey Michael, In short I think it closes too many doors. Sure it'll work well for some people and to be completely honest I haven't used it in our business but from experience, low and high ticket businesses just want to know the price and they want you to get to the point. I'm always open to learning and testing things but cost based seems simple. How much for a video? £2k.. OK cool (or if not) OK what's the budget, where can we make a saving. You also have a fair basis so that when you get a referral (which we get lots of) the expectations are already taken care of. Its not a case of "I want a video, how much?" ... well how much do you value video 😂. Just my opinion and again I'm not super uptodate with the strategy 🙏🏼
